
Casorti, The Technics of Bowing Op. 50 for Violin (Schirmer)
"Technics of Bowing" by August Casorti, Op. 50, edited by Mittel and published by G. Schirmer, is a 28-page guidebook for violinists seeking to improve their bowing techniques.
